Product Specific Applications Use of equipment in unintended applications may result in serious WARNING injury or death. Maximum 1 attachment per connection point. Personal Fall Arrest: Permanent Adjustable Standing Seam Roof Anchor may be used to support a MAXIMUM 1 PFAS for use in Fall Arrest applications. Structure must withstand loads applied in the directions permitted by the system of at least 5,000 lbs.
Limitations Fall Clearance: There must be sufficient clearance below the anchorage connector to arrest a fall before the user strikes the ground or any obstruction. When calculating fall clearance, account for a MINIMUM 2’ safety factor, free fall, deceleration distance, harness stretch, swing fall, and all other applicable factors. Compatibility: When making connections with Permanent Adjustable Standing Seam Roof Anchor, eliminate all possibility of roll-out. Roll-out occurs when interference between a hook and the attachment point causes the hook gate to unintentionally open and release. All connections must be selected and deemed compatible with Permanent Adjustable Standing Seam Roof Anchor by a Competent Person.

Maintenance, Cleaning, and Storage If Permanent Adjustable Standing Seam Roof Anchor fails inspection in any way, immediately remove it from service, and contact Guardian to inquire about its return or repair. Field serviceability testing is not required, and should not be done by the end user. Cleaning after use is important for maintaining the safety and longevity of Permanent Adjustable Standing Seam Roof Anchor.
